May have ruined DS puffer jacket

7 replies

Tulipomania · 14/02/2022 08:47

I washed it on a gentle cycle (my machine actually has a cycle for outerwear) at 30 then tumble dried on low with tennis balls, and still the filling has clumped.

Is there anything I can do to rescue it?

Deux · 14/02/2022 11:56

The feathers will be clumped together. You can loosen them by pulling them apart with your fingers in each of the stitched pockets/channels, then back in the tumble dryer and repeat.
